In which area is it crucial to monitor groundwater contamination?

Monitoring groundwater contamination in urban and industrial areas is crucial due to the high potential for pollutants to leach into the aquifers that serve as sources of drinking water and irrigation. These areas often have a concentration of activities and infrastructure, such as factories, landfills, and sewage systems, that can introduce various contaminants into the soil and groundwater. Substances like heavy metals, industrial solvents, and chemicals can easily infiltrate groundwater resources, posing significant health risks to populations relying on this water for consumption or agricultural use.

In contrast, while agricultural fields and residential areas also require monitoring, the risks and sources of contamination tend to be more localized or less variable compared to the higher volume and variety of contamination sources found in urban and industrial settings. Monitoring in these regions is essential, but urban and industrial areas pose unique and widespread challenges that necessitate more rigorous surveillance. Remote regions may have fewer immediate sources of contamination but could still be at risk, particularly from environmental factors or long-distance contamination transport. Therefore, focusing on urban and industrial regions is critical for comprehensive groundwater protection efforts.
